Roofing systems have become very standardized in the philippines.
These terms are a carryover from the spanish un tejado de dos aguas a simple ridged roof or un tejado de quatro aguas a hip roof.
Traditional philippines houses had dos aguas or quatro aguas roofs.

For rib type designs the price of yero is 120 for 0 4 millimeters 150 for 0 5 millimeters and 180 for 0 6 millimeters.
The corrugated type designs are priced as the same with the rib types.
